I am headed out to Area 5 pretty soon, and that will be the first major match of the year. Coming into it, I feel pretty confident, but not really perfectly polished like I want to be. I do feel a need to work on strong hand only/ weak hand only and also reload speed.

To work on my single handed shooting, I have decided to work on a drill called triple six (it is in the drill section), but I want to do triple six with a twist. For those that don’t know, triple six is an 18 shot, 3 string drill. From the holster, 6 shots on one target at 7 yards. Then 6 shots on one target at 15 yards, then 6 shots at 25 yards. All 3 string times are added together, along with .1 second for every point dropped. The total time is your score.

For reference sake, a really good score for me freestyle is under 7 seconds. After working this drill just a little bit strong hand and weak hand, I came up with some times I consider “doable”

Strong Hand Only:

7 Yard 2.2

15Yard 3.2

25 Yard 4.5

Total: 9.9 + a few points down = 11

Weak Hand Only:

7 Yard 3.5

15Yard 4.5

25 Yard 5.75

Total: 13.75 + a few points down = 14.75

So… something for me to shoot for I suppose. I find left handed shooting VERY difficult at 25 yards… especially when I am trying to be fast. After some work on this, I hope to be better.
